The property market in Eagley Bank has had a steep increase over the last few years but slowing growth. Based on data published on 15 November 2023, on average a detached house costs £341,643, which is up 2.0% on last year. A semi-detached house on average costs £201,502 (up 0.4% on last year) , a terraced house £148,902 (down -0.6% on last year) and a flat £112,335. Renting a two bedroom flat will cost you approximately £534 per month. Property prices in Eagley Bank are slightly lower than the average property prices across Greater Manchester and are much lower compared to other locations with a similar density in England. When looking at the annual change in property prices in Eagley Bank, prices have risen much slower than the annual average price change seen across the Greater Manchester region.
Property data is based on Bolton level pricing data and is as at September 2023 (publicised 15 November 2023)

We use an API provided by Department for Environment Food & Rural Affairs (DEFRA) to identify any live flood warnings to be aware of and we also provide insight into whether flooding could occur from rivers, sea and groundwater within 1km of Eagley Bank.
There are no live flood warnings in the area, according to our interpretation of the DEFRA API.
The areas in the table below have been identified by the DEFRA API as areas where it is possible for flooding to occur from rivers, sea and in some locations, groundwater. Some of these areas will have measures in place to minimise the risk of flooding and they may be monitored by the Flood Warning Service.
Area | Cause | Description |
---|---|---|
Gtr Mancs Mersey and Ches | River Irwell | Upper Irwell catchment includes the Rivers Beal, Roch and Croal, Limey Water and their tributaries. Other locations which may be affected are around Farnworth, Whitefield, Little Lever, Radcliffe, Bury, Heywood, Whitworth and Bacup |
Gtr Mancs Mersey and Ches | Eagley Brook | Areas at risk include properties on Blackburn Road, adjacent to Gale Brook, and at Stable Fold farm |
Gtr Mancs Mersey and Ches | Eagley Brook, River Tongue | Areas at risk include the riding school, parts of Yew Tree Farm, and New Progress Works. Also at risk are properties on Waterside Gardens, Eagley Brook Way, and some property on Astley Brook Close |
Gtr Mancs Mersey and Ches | Eagley Brook | Areas at risk include properties adjacent to the river, off Threadfold Way at Brook Mill, Wakefield Mews and Cottonfields |
